Snow Rider 3D, unlike classic platformers with predefined, memorizable levels, relies on procedural creation as its primary hostile force. The course is not static; it is created on the fly, guaranteeing that no two runs are ever exactly same. This design decision is critical because it radically changes the nature of the problem, from rote memorization to pure, instantaneous adaptability. The player cannot beat the game by studying the position of each barrier; instead, they must acquire the abilities required to conquer any obstacle, regardless of its location.
